Benefits and Drawbacks of Using Epoxy over Ground Concrete
Epoxy flooring has acquired immense popularity in recent years due to its durability, visual attractiveness, and ease of upkeep. However, before deciding to apply epoxy over ground concrete, it's crucial to analyze the implications. On the positive side, epoxy delivers a smooth, uniform surface that is immune to scratches, stains, and chemicals. It also boosts the overall appearance of the floor and can be customized with various colors and textures. On the other hand, epoxy application can be a involved process that requires specialized labor. The material itself can also be pricey, and proper surface preparation is essential for a effective outcome. Furthermore, epoxy flooring can be prone to damage from severe blows, and repairs may require expertise.
Understanding Concrete Grinding for Epoxy Applications
Concrete grinding holds paramount importance role in epoxy applications. It guarantees a smooth surface, which is the optimal foundation for epoxy resins. Meticulous grinding eradicates imperfections like cracks, protrusions, and residues, generating a surface that is excellent adhesion.
Before applying epoxy, the concrete must be completely ground for the purpose of obtaining a compatible surface profile. The thickness of grinding fluctuates depending on the nature of existing defects.
- Seek guidance from a qualified professional to establish the appropriate grinding depth
- Utilize a concrete grinder equipped with diamond segments for optimal effectiveness
- Affirm that the grinding operation is executed in accordance with safety regulations
After grinding, it is paramount to remove any leftover dust or debris. This promotes a higher quality bond between the concrete and the epoxy coating.
Coating Concrete for Epoxy Installation
When it comes to achieving a durable and attractive epoxy coating on your concrete surface, preparation is key. Begin by thoroughly cleaning the substrate with a pressure washer or a stiff brush and solvent. This will get rid of any loose debris, dirt, oil, or grease that could hinder proper bonding. Next, examine the concrete for any cracks or deterioration and repair them with a suitable concrete patching product. Allow the repair to cure completely according to the manufacturer's instructions before proceeding.
After the concrete is clean and repaired, you'll need to grind the surface to create a better surface for the epoxy. This can be achieved using a concrete grinder or a diamond disk.
